What Does Fellowship Still Penalize When A Dungeon Runs Overtime?
Fellowship removes overtime item-level losses across all leagues. Dungeon Score and Eternal Shards still suffer, and Reforge has strict recovery limits.
Dungeon Score and Eternal Shards still carry overtime consequences in Fellowship. Loot item level no longer does: update 0.4.5.0, released September 16, removes the equipment penalty for finishing more than ten percent over the dungeon timer.
What does a late clear still cost?
The removal applies across every league and difficulty. A party that completes an overtimed dungeon can receive its intended reward item level, even though its score and shard outcome still suffer from missing time.
That gives equipment-focused players a reason to finish after the timer has been missed. It does not make a late clear equivalent to a timed one, or guarantee that other party members will stay.

Can you recover an item scrapped by mistake?
The same update adds Reforge at the Scrapper. It retains the last twenty scrapped items for up to twelve hours and lets you recover them by paying back the currency received from scrapping them. Open Reforge promptly: both the time window and the item-history limit matter.
In its September 19 Campfire Checkpoint, Chief Rebel said the old loot penalty gave players another reason to leave late runs. The studio will monitor the response. The equipment protection is live; a reduction in abandoned groups has yet to be demonstrated.
